At War with the Army functions primarily as a vehicle for slapstick humor rather than a study of identity. The narrative relies on the friction between individual buffoonery and institutional rigidity to drive its comedy. The film adheres strictly to the social and demographic norms of the mid-century studio system. It prioritizes traditional comedic formulas over any progressive narrative subversion or systemic critique of authority. Ultimately, the work lacks the complexity needed to engage with multiple aspects of identity. It reinforces the era's standard demographic norms through a narrow, male-centric lens.
Category Breakdown
The film does not depict any non-straight gender identities or same-sex relationships. The story focuses only on heterosexual relationships and a male-dominated military environment.
The story takes place in a heavily male-dominated space. Women are placed on the sidelines, serving as distant motivators for the male protagonists rather than active participants.
The cast reflects a homogeneous demographic typical of the 1950s. There is no evidence of significant racial or ethnic diversity or characters of color with substantial roles.
The film upholds traditional Western institutions through a comedic lens. Values are centered on traditional family units and the preservation of the status quo.
There are no visible or invisible disabilities portrayed with significant roles. The film focuses on the physical comedy of able-bodied characters.

Official Synopsis
Two former nightclub partners are now enlisted in the Army. Sergeant Puccinelli ranks above his former partner, Private First Class Korwin. Puccinelli is desperately trying to get transferred from his dull job to active duty overseas. Meanwhile, all Korwin wants is a pass to see his wife and new baby.
